TROY — Lactose intolerance be damned.
Melt N’ Toast, the Capital District’s first major grilled cheese festival, will take place this fall on Saturday, Nov. 18 from noon to 4 p.m at the Takk House.
The festival showcases the Capital District’s culinary and craft beverage landscape, featuring the creativity of local food vendors paired with regional craft beverage producers. Whether it is stacked with classic or artisan ingredients, the combinations are endless, and everyone has their own way of enjoying a grilled cheese sandwich.
Ticketholders will taste delicious chefs’ choice grilled cheese creations, paired with a featured local craft beverage selection, and vote for your best Melt N’ Toast combo. Also be ready to “meltn’ groove” with live DJ talent.
Participating restaurants include Slidin’ Dirty, Sunhee’s Farm + Kitchen, Muddaddy Flats, Dinner Demon, the Cheese Traveler, Savoy Taproom, Merv’s Meatless, and Fresh Greens at the Park. Judges include Yelp’s Daniel Berman, CBS 6’s Emily DeFeciani, and a mystery judge — two awards will be given, one for Judge’s Cheese and People’s Cheese (voted on by attendees). Beverage producers include Nine Pin Cider, Chatham Brewing, Rare Form Brewing, The Beer Diviner, and MJM World Imports.
Tickets are available for either $40 for general admission, $70 for VIP/all you can cheese and can be purchased at meltntoastny.com. The event is presented in support by All Over Albany and Yelp Albany and hosted by Relentless Events.
